引言
在当今信息化时代,数据已成为企业的重要资产。采集运维作为数据采集和运维的关键环节,其重要性不言而喻。本文将从零开始,详细介绍采集运维的必备业务技能与实操指南,帮助读者快速入门并掌握这一领域。
一、采集运维概述
1.1 定义
采集运维是指通过对企业内部及外部数据进行采集、处理、存储、分析和应用,为企业提供决策支持的过程。它涵盖了数据采集、数据存储、数据分析和数据应用等多个方面。
1.2 采集运维的重要性
- 提高数据质量:通过采集运维,可以确保数据的一致性、准确性和完整性,为后续的数据分析和应用提供可靠的基础。
- 优化业务流程:采集运维可以帮助企业优化业务流程,提高工作效率。
- 支持决策制定:采集运维可以为企业管理层提供有价值的数据分析结果,支持决策制定。
二、采集运维必备业务技能
2.1 数据采集技能
- 熟悉各种数据采集方法,如日志采集、API接口采集、数据库采集等。
- 了解常见的数据采集工具,如Flume、Kafka、Logstash等。
- 掌握数据采集过程中的异常处理和优化技巧。
2.2 数据存储技能
- 熟悉常见的数据存储技术,如关系型数据库、NoSQL数据库、分布式存储等。
- 了解数据存储系统的架构和性能优化方法。
- 掌握数据备份和恢复技术。
2.3 数据分析技能
- 熟悉数据分析工具,如Python、R、Spark等。
- 掌握数据分析方法,如数据挖掘、机器学习等。
- 能够根据业务需求进行数据可视化。
2.4 数据应用技能
- 了解常见的数据应用场景,如大数据分析、人工智能等。
- 掌握数据应用开发技术,如Hadoop、Spark等。
- 能够将数据分析结果应用于实际业务场景。
三、采集运维实操指南
3.1 数据采集实操
- 设计数据采集方案,明确采集目标、数据源、采集频率等。
- 选择合适的采集工具,如Flume、Kafka等。
- 编写采集脚本,实现数据采集功能。
- 对采集数据进行异常处理和优化。
3.2 数据存储实操
- 选择合适的存储系统,如MySQL、MongoDB等。
- 设计数据存储架构,包括数据表结构、索引、分区等。
- 实现数据导入、导出、备份和恢复功能。
- 对存储系统进行性能优化。
3.3 数据分析实操
- 选择合适的数据分析工具,如Python、R等。
- 编写数据分析脚本,实现数据清洗、处理和分析。
- 对分析结果进行可视化展示。
- 将分析结果应用于实际业务场景。
3.4 数据应用实操
- 了解业务需求,明确数据应用目标。
- 选择合适的数据应用技术,如Hadoop、Spark等。
- 编写数据应用开发代码。
- 对应用系统进行测试和优化。
结语
采集运维是数据时代的重要技能,掌握采集运维的相关知识和技能,将有助于你在职场中脱颖而出。本文从零开始,详细介绍了采集运维的必备业务技能与实操指南,希望对你有所帮助。在实际工作中,不断学习和实践,才能不断提升自己的采集运维能力。
